The measure of human demands on Earth’s natural resources is known as our ecological footprint. Currently, we use the equivalent of 1.5 Earths to produce all the renewable resources we use. Food aid forestalls …Growth in global goods trade will recover modestly in 2024, following a significant slowdown in 2023. This will reflect a pick-up in US and EU demand and stronger factory activity in Asia. High global interest rates and fragile investor sentiment will keep goods trade growth from returning to pandemic-era highs. About 700 million people live on less than $2.15 per day, the extreme poverty line. Extreme poverty remains concentrated in parts of Sub-Saharan Africa, fragile and conflict-affected areas, and rural areas. After decades of progress, the pace of global poverty reduction began to slow by 2015, in tandem with subdued …
